This course is an interdisciplinary, multimedia study of the cultural, political, philosophical, and aesthetic factors critical to the formulation of values and the historical development of the individual and of society. This semester focuses on works from the Renaissance, the Reformation and counter-Reformation, the Baroque world, the age of Reason and Neoclassicism, the Romantic era, and the twentieth century. (3 lecture hours per week). Prerequisites: READ 0310 and ENGL 0310. [ CB24.0103.5112]
